Funding Experts. Friendly Faces.

Formerly named Fairtax Grants & Incentives, the GrantMatch team has been in the game for more than 25 years. Led by Managing Partners Dan Civiero and Mike Janke, GrantMatch has collectively secured over $300 million in government funding dollars for a wide range of clientele.
